The California Supreme Court Wednesday denied Republicans petition asking the court to stop state officials from putting a redistricting measure on the ballot the second GOP challenge to the states redistricting its thrown out in one week.
The decision appears to smooth the way for the measure to appear on the ballot in November.
Democrats in the California legislature passed a proposed congressional map last week aimed at countering a Texas gerrymander that could add five Republican seats in Congress in 2026. As part of their Election Rigging Response Act, California lawmakers also authorized a special election Nov. 4 for voters to decide whether the state will adopt the new map via a constitutional amendment.
The GOP lawsuit argued that lawmakers arent authorized to draw their own congressional map because Californias redistricting process is run by an independent commission.
